A bill for an act
relating to arts assistance; requiring the Board of the Arts to establish and
administer a revolving loan fund to assist rural Minnesota cultural facilities
construction projects; appropriating money; amending Minnesota Statutes 2004,
section 129D.04, subdivision 1.

B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A:

Section 1.

Minnesota Statutes 2004, section 129D.04, subdivision 1, is amended to
read:


Subdivision 1.

Authority.

The board shall through the following activities stimulate
and encourage the creation, performance and appreciation of the arts in the state:

(1) receive and consider any requests for grants, loans or other forms of assistance;

(2) advise and serve as a technical resource at the request of sponsoring organizations
and political subdivisions in the state on programs relating to the arts;

(3) advise and recommend on existing or proposed activities of the departments
of the state relating to the arts;

(4) accept gifts and grants to the board and distribute the same in accordance with
the instructions of the donor insofar as the instructions are consistent with law;

(5) promulgate by rule procedures to be followed by the board in receiving and
reviewing requests for grants, loans or other forms of assistance;

(6) promulgate by rule standards consistent with this chapter to be followed by the
board in the distribution of grants, loans, and other forms of assistance;

(7) distribute according to the above procedures and standards grants, loans, and
other forms of assistance for artistic activities to departments and agencies of the state,
political subdivisions, sponsoring organizations and, in appropriate cases, to individuals
engaged in the creation or performance of the arts; provided that a member of the board
shall not participate in deliberations or voting on assistance to groups or persons in which
that member has an interest as officer, director, employee, or recipient;

(8) appoint advisory committees which the board determines are essential to the
performance of its powers and duties under this section; provided that no member of an
advisory committee shall serve on a committee to which the member has an application
pending for a grant, loan, or other form of assistance from the board or its predecessor;

(9) serve as a fiscal agent to disburse appropriations for regional arts councils
